Coffee Memo | Rob Talks Pipeline, Producers, Prices Ep. 18

Beschrijving

Takeaways * The coffee market is currently experiencing a sideways trading pattern. * Producers are holding onto coffee due to strong financial positions. * There is a large crop expected from Brazil, which may affect prices. * Physical storage issues may compel producers to sell coffee. * Market sentiment suggests prices may drop as supply increases. * Producers are psychologically positioned to wait for better prices. * The coffee supply chain is facing historic lows in inventory. * Market movements can happen slowly and then all at once. * Producers are gambling with their coffee supply until the market changes.     Part of The Covoya Coffee Podcasting Network [https://www.covoyacoffee.com/podcast]   TAKE OUR LISTENER SURVEY [https://www.surveymonkey.com/r/9Z2WF6C]   Visit and Explore Covoya! Extra Shot | Update on Coffee Consumer Behavior Ep. 16

Takeaways * 59% of coffee drinkers changed at least one coffee buying behavior. * Overall daily coffee consumption remains steady at 66%. * Specialty coffee consumption increased from 55% to 58%. * Daily use of espresso machines at home increased from 10% to 13%. * Convenience often outweighs quality in coffee preparation. * 29% reported their financial situation worsened over the last six months. * 37% of Americans are dining out less frequently. * Diners are looking to spend less money when eating out. * Coffee drinkers are reducing purchases from cafes and restaurants. * Coffee roasters can adapt to changing consumer preferences.     Part of The Covoya Coffee Podcasting Network [https://www.covoyacoffee.com/podcast]   TAKE OUR LISTENER SURVEY [https://www.surveymonkey.com/r/9Z2WF6C]   Visit and Explore Covoya! Coffee Memo | Rob Talks El Nino Ep. 19

Takeaways * Weather is a powerful and often misunderstood aspect of the coffee industry. * El Niño and La Niña significantly influence coffee production and market dynamics. * The impact of weather on coffee is not uniform; it varies by region and time. * Coffee trees require specific weather conditions at critical growth stages. * Understanding weather patterns helps in assessing risks in coffee production. * El Niño can create both risks and opportunities for coffee growers. * Regional data is crucial for understanding the specific impacts of weather on coffee. * Having a contingency plan is essential in coffee. * The conversation emphasizes the importance of separating signal from noise in weather-related news.   Part of The Covoya Coffee Podcasting Network [https://www.covoyacoffee.com/podcast]   TAKE OUR LISTENER SURVEY [https://www.surveymonkey.com/r/9Z2WF6C]   Visit and Explore Covoya!
